kanxrus Posted April 19, 2009 Report Share Posted April 19, 2009 THIS IS A TEST BETWEEN THE NEW RIDGID R86030 IMPACT DRIVER vs THE DEWALT DC827 IMPACT DRIVER! THIS TEST WILL COMPARE INTERNAL SPECS, DEMO TESTING, WEIGHT, FEATURES AND BENEFITS! WEIGHT: INTERNAL SPECS: FEATURES AND BENEFITS: ONTO THE TEST: WE DID TWO TESTS. FIRST TEST, RUNITME. HOW MANY LAG'S IN AND OUT ON A SINGLE CHARGE? SECOND TEST, SPEED OF A HEAVY APPLICATION. SPEED OF APPLICATION. TEST RESULTS: FIRST TEST: RIDGID R86030 11 1/2 3/8"x 3" LAGS DOWN, 7 LAGS UP DEWALT DC827 13 1/2 3/8"X3" LAGS DOWN, 9 LAGS UP SECOND TEST: RIDGID R86030 3/8" x 6" LAG DRIVEN IN 58 SECONDS.
